    Q: How does the AI work?
  14. 14
    A: The AI gets progressively 'better' as the sets go.
  15. 15
    Set 1-2 has Random AI (Uses random moves. Switches are not random, however.)
  16. 16
    Set 3-4 has Semi-Random AI (Will not use a move that does nothing, but otherwise choses random moves)
  17. 17
    Set 5 onwards, and fight 21 with Noland has Good AI (Tries to use best move in all scenarios. Some weighting is still weird, though.)

    Q: When do you do swaps?
  20. 20
    A: Only when it actually makes the team better. Swapping is more beneficial in Gen 4 Factory than Gen 3, in Gen 3 it's not worth doing for the increase in "better pokes", and during the set if you swap, you're actually swapping for a worse IV poke.
  21. 21
    This is because opponents have IVs of 3 for their Pokemon (excluding the 7th battle), whereas the IVs for your Pokemon are 3 in the first set, but then go up to 6 for the second, 9 for the third, etc.

    Q: What power does Return / Frustration have?
  30. 30
    A: Always max, no matter which, so 102.
